Three markets, one stack
Tesla is attacking humanoid robots with Optimus, transportation with robotaxi and full self-driving, and energy with Megapack, Powerwall, storage, and solar. Combined addressable market: tens of trillions of dollars a year. The same underlying tech—AI in the physical world—feeds all three. That overlap is the point. Most companies get one lane. Tesla is trying to own the intersection.
Start with robotaxi. Cybercab is aimed at roughly $25,000 to manufacture at scale, maybe under $20,000. Operating cost lands near 30 cents a mile once the fleet is scaled. Compare that to a typical Uber ride: driver economics around $1.80 a mile before Uber's cut, which pushes the rider toward something like $2.50–$3.00 a mile. If Tesla can charge about a dollar a mile, keep the rider experience high, and still pocket roughly seventy cents of profit per mile, the gap is structural. These cars can run 18–20 hours a day. No bathroom breaks. No weekends. No health insurance. One Cybercab can replace three to five human drivers on hours alone.
Scale that. Tesla has talked about millions of Cybercabs a year at volume. If each vehicle throws off something like $50,000 to $100,000 in annual profit, you are staring at $100–$200 billion a year from robotaxi alone. That is not a rounding error on an auto P&L. That is a different company.
Now Optimus. Elon has called a general-purpose humanoid the biggest product of all time. Strip the hype and the first-principles math still bites: a robot that handles maybe 80% of physical tasks humans do, built for about $20,000 at scale, running at an all-in cost near three dollars an hour including electricity and maintenance. Twenty-four hours. No HR. No workers' comp. Global labor is measured in tens of trillions. Capture even a thin slice by putting millions of Optimus units into factories, warehouses, and eventually homes, and you get a business that swallows legacy industrial categories whole.
Energy is already moving. Tesla's energy segment has been growing faster than automotive on a percentage basis. Megapack lets utilities squeeze more out of existing grids by buffering power—no new plant required. Energy margins have sat near 30% versus roughly 18% for cars. In an AI era that eats electricity, that is a high-margin growth engine, not a side quest.

The objections are real
Key-man risk is the elephant. Tesla without Elon is a different company. Farzad worked there four years; he has seen how deep those fingerprints go—engineering calls, manufacturing pace, culture. Elon runs like Jobs: impossible targets, forced breakthroughs. If something happened to him, the stock would get crushed overnight and long-term direction would get foggy. Call him an accelerant for the future, not a replaceable middle manager.
Counterpoints exist. The bench is deeper than critics admit—Ashok on AI, Lars on engineering, processes that keep the factory floor moving. The new compensation package locks Elon in for roughly a decade with milestones tied to an $8.5 trillion valuation. That mitigates. It does not erase. If you own Tesla, you are partly owning Elon's vision and execution. Get comfortable with that or do not own it.
Regulatory risk is next. Robotaxi at full Cybercab design needs rules to catch up. In the U.S., vehicles without steering wheels and pedals still face a 2,500-unit-per-year cap. Without a change, Tesla may have to ship Cybercabs with wheels and pedals just to keep the line humming. That works as a bridge. It is not the ideal end state, and it can shove the timeline.
Execution risk is baked in. Tesla has missed timelines repeatedly. Full self-driving was "solved" in marketing years before it was solved on the road. Assume years of delay—maybe a decade—on the biggest visions. Competition is not imaginary either. Waymo already runs real robotaxi miles. Figure and 1X are building humanoids. China is pouring capital into EVs and robotics. First-mover edges erode if you sleep.
Farzad's answer is not "ignore risk." Every investment carries risk. What almost nobody else has is the combo: real-world AI, manufacturing scale, supply-chain control, and a product map spanning transport, energy, and robotics. Waymo does not build the cars at Tesla's scale. Legacy OEMs do not have the AI stack. Many Chinese players lack Western market access. Tesla is an N-of-one.
